The Scrambler family steals our hearts with these prototypes that, hopefully, will hit the streets

Revealed to the world in Bike Shed Moto Show some days ago, Ducati unveiled two new prototypes of its Scrambler. On the one hand, the CR241 and, on the other, the Scrambler RR241. Quite different because the CR241 It is an agile-looking cafe racer, with a stylized semi-fairing, and the RR241which is an epic dirt track creation with a much tougher look.

Both models are based on the robust range Scrambler, equipped with the Desmodue 803 cc air-cooled V-Twin engine and a tubular steel chassis. These motorcycles are part of the current portfolio of Ducatispecifically in the Nightshift, Icon and Full Throttle versions.

These are the two new prototypes of the Scrambler

Starting with the CR241, the inspiration for its design is clear. Evokes classic icons such as Ducati 750SS of the seventies and the Pantah from the early eighties. In this variant, the standard 18-inch front wheel has been replaced by a sportier 17-inch one, and the mixed tires have been replaced with rubber suitable for the road.

At the rear, the wide, flat seat has been modified to include a removable cover of the same color for the passenger seat. Clip-on handlebars and bar-end mirrors replace tall bars. And a semi-fairing that kicks off the tank completes its athletic appearance. Despite the sportier look, the power is likely to remain the same, with 72.2 HP.

On the other hand, the Scrambler RR241 presents a more robust aesthetic, inspired by Ducati in post-apocalyptic films and series such as «Mad Max«. With a street tracker look, the RR241 has an exhaust Termignoni high exit, a raised front fender and spoked wheels (with a 17-inch rear and an 18-inch front, like the current Nightshift). Of course, highlight the tires Pirelli Scorpion Rally STR 50/50.

Despite their off-road appearance, the chassis and suspension components appear to be the same on both models, sharing the components Kayaba 150 mm of travel from the rest of the range, which limits its real capacity for really difficult terrain.

While the previous model Desert Sled It had a reinforced suspension and a larger front wheel, this new variant is more urban than adventurous. At least now.

Ducati has replaced the tank side panel covers with protective bars, which they suggest could be used to secure luggage. In addition, the passenger seat can be removed to install an always practical luggage rack. An extra practicality that never hurts when traveling.

We still do not know if these prototypes will enter the production phase. But what we do know is that some surprise will be in store for us. scrambler family Ducati for next season. Or at least, that's what it looks like.
